Energy is a precious resource in Wireless Sensor Nodes. With each transmission/reception and computation, energy is being expended and batteries get drained which can result in premature death of nodes and thereby reduced life span of WSN. The problem gets critical when the network is implemented under harsh environmental conditions like forests. Thus energy harvesting from environment becomes an important concern. In this paper, a design is presented for the development of power management system in an energy constraint device like wireless sensor node. The design presented utilizes solar energy to improve the efficiency and extend the duration of operation for sensor nodes. Experimental setup comprises of a PV based array simulator and a CPLD based power management module.
